Folks I am receiving my top end back in a day or so. here is my setup topend bored .60 over new weisco piston and rings, Trail ported, Alum. Airbox with Uni filter, Boyseen Carbon reeds, Head mod by Ken, FMF fatty, FMF powercore 2, reed spacer, However right now I am running a 30mm OKO, I have purchased a new intake manifold and 34mm Mikuni flatslide. Is this too much carb for my setup? Also I have already done the timing mod but currently running at stock, will bumping the timing up help at all? I was told dont bump the timing up with the head mod by ken. What are your thoughts?
 
I am running basically that same setup except for a toomey. Been struggling a little with the new tm but I think i finally got it figured out. Ran it all weekend with no problems. Really struggled with the pilot. Kept going lean after letting off the throttle when warm. Ended up with a 50 pilot, stock needle, and 240 main. Might be a tad rich on the main, but it runs good.
